What Even Is 75 Ball Bingo? (And Why Do I Care About Free Spins?)

If you’ve never played it, 75 ball bingo uses a 5×5 grid. You mark off numbers as they are called. The goal is to complete a specific pattern. It could be a straight line, an X, a blackout (covering the whole card), or something weird like a letter or a shape. It’s faster than 90-ball and feels more like a game of chance mixed with a puzzle.

Now, the free spins part. A lot of these bingo sites are actually hybrid casinos. They have a bingo lobby AND a slot section. So when they say “free spins”, they are usually giving you spins on a specific slot (like Starburst or Book of Dead) just for signing up or depositing for bingo. It’s a two-for-one deal. How to Actually Get the Best 75 Ball Bingo Sites UK 2026 Free Spins (Without Getting Ripped Off)

I’ve been burned before. I once signed up for a “massive” offer only to find the free spins had a 72-hour expiry. I work night shifts. I couldn’t even use them in time. So here is a short guide on how to play it smart.

Step 1: Check the Expiry Date.
Most free spins are valid for 24 to 72 hours. If you are a weekend player like me, sign up on a Friday evening. That way you have Saturday to use them. Do not sign up on a Tuesday morning if you work 9-5. You will lose them.

Step 2: Read the Wagering Requirements.
I hate this bit. But you have to do it. Look for a number. 30x is good. 40x is okay. 50x is a trap. Avoid it. Also, check if the wagering is on the bonus amount only or on the bonus plus deposit. “Bonus + deposit” is worse. For example, if you deposit £10 and get £10 in spins, wagering 35x on the bonus is £350. Wagering 35x on bonus + deposit is £700. Big difference.

Step 3: Find the Max Cashout.
This is the killer. Look for “max withdrawal from bonus” or “max cashout”. Anything under £50 is a joke. Aim for £100 or more. PlayOJO is the best here because they have no limit, but they don’t always have the best 75 ball bingo rooms. You can’t have everything.

Step 4: See If It Works on Bingo or Just Slots.
Sometimes the free spins are only for slots. That’s fine if you like slots. But if you came for the bingo, you might be disappointed. Look for “bingo bonus” or “bingo ticket” offers instead. Some sites, like Mr Green, offer “free bingo tickets” instead of spins. That is actually better for a bingo player.

What is the difference between 75 ball and 90 ball bingo?

90 ball is the traditional UK version with three chances to win per game (one line, two lines, full house). 75 ball is the American style with a 5×5 grid and pattern-based wins. It is faster and often has higher prizes. The best 75 ball bingo sites uk 2026 free spins offers are usually targeting players who want this faster pace.
